noun
-
An organized search for a criminal or enemy.
“After the murderer escaped, there was a full-scale manhunt to catch him.”
-
A variant of hide and seek in which a player who is caught by the seeker themselves becomes a seeker, and the final player remaining is declared the winner.
“Manhunt is a variant of hide-and-seek, she tells me. One person is the seeker. Everyone else hides. If the seeker finds you, you become a seeker, too.”
